How they compare
France currently reports 117 Cases against 104 Cases in Madagascar, a difference of 13 Cases.
That makes France's figure about 1.1 times Madagascar's.
The two have swapped places 4 times across 44 shared years of data; in 1976 it was Madagascar ahead.
France ranks 81st and Madagascar ranks 83rd of 210 countries.
Across the 6 decades both report, France averaged higher in 1 and Madagascar in 5.
Head to head by decade
| Decade | France | Madagascar | Difference | Ahead |
|---|---|---|---|---|
| 1970s | 2,086 Cases | 102,889 Cases | 100,803 Cases | Madagascar |
| 1980s | 909.43 Cases | 86,439 Cases | 85,530 Cases | Madagascar |
| 1990s | 75,319 Cases | 12,240 Cases | 63,080 Cases | France |
| 2000s | 3,430 Cases | 17,098 Cases | 13,668 Cases | Madagascar |
| 2010s | 3,446 Cases | 23,468 Cases | 20,022 Cases | Madagascar |
| 2020s | 97 Cases | 314 Cases | 217 Cases | Madagascar |
Averages of every year both report within each decade.

About this data
Reported cases of measles with 433 missing years estimated by linear interpolation between the nearest real observations. Only gaps of 4 years or fewer are filled, and never beyond the first or last actual measurement — these are filled holes, not forecasts.
